1. Return on Investment (ROI): The Financial Reality Check
In 2026, ROI isn't just about the "starting package"—it’s about how quickly you can nullify your student debt and start building wealth.
Tuition & Costs
Scaler School of Technology: The total investment for the 4-year residential program sits around ₹23–₹25 Lakhs. This covers tuition, high-speed campus residency in Bangalore, and access to specialized labs.
Traditional B.Tech: Top private universities like VIT or SRM now range between ₹10–₹20 Lakhs. Subsidized government institutions (IITs/NITs) remain at ₹8–₹12 Lakhs, though the "hidden costs" of coaching for entrance exams often add another ₹3–₹5 Lakhs to this tally.
Earning Potential & Payback Period
For 2026, Scaler reports average placement projections matching top-tier colleges at around ₹18–₹21.6 LPA. In contrast, Tier-2 and Tier-3 traditional colleges usually struggle with averages between ₹4–₹7 LPA.
The math is simple: A Scaler graduate landing an elite tech role typically recoups their investment in 1.5 to 2 years. A student from a lower-tier traditional program often takes 4 to 5 years just to break even.

The Academic Validity Question
A common concern for students is the "degree." While Scaler bypasses standard AICTE structures to maintain curriculum agility, they pair their practical training with a parallel degree from a UGC-recognized university partner (like BITS Pilani). This ensures that if you want to pursue a Master’s abroad or sit for a government exam, your academic validity is fully intact.

Q4. Does Scaler accept JEE scores?
No. Scaler uses its own entrance test (NSET) which focuses on logic, math, and problem-solving rather than chemistry or physics memorization.
